Abstract
The present invention relates to methods for preventing the development of epithelial ovarian cancer by administering a Vitamin D compound in an amount capable of increasing apoptosis in non-neoplastic ovarian epithelial cells of the female subject.

- 1. A pharmaceutical combination comprising 28 daily sequential dosages, said product including 21 sequential daily hormone dosages, with each hormone dosage comprising a progestin product and an estrogen product and with at least one of said hormone dosages further comprising a Vitamin D compound, and said product further including 7 other daily dosages that do not contain either estrogen and/or progestin and wherein said product is adapted for administration of said Vitamin D compound on a less frequently than daily basis.
- 17. A pharmaceutical combination comprising 21 sequential daily dosages, said 21 daily dosages comprising a progestin product and/or an estrogen product, with at least one of said daily dosages further comprising a Vitamin D compound that does not have hydroxylation at both the 1 and 25 positions and wherein said product is adapted for administration of said Vitamin D compound on a less frequently than daily basis.
- 31. A pharmaceutical combination comprising 21 sequential daily dosages, said 21 daily dosages comprising a progestin product and/or an estrogen product, with at least one of said daily dosages further comprising a Vitamin D compound, and wherein said product is adapted for administration of said Vitamin D compound on a less frequently than daily basis.
